Artificial pollination device for flower planting

By introducing a storage cylinder, a blocking plate, and a sliding column structure into the artificial pollination device for flower cultivation, the pollen drop is controlled. Combined with the shaking of the brush head, the problems of pollen waste and damage to the pistils are solved, achieving efficient utilization of pollen and protection of the pistils.

Abstract

The utility model relates to the technical field of flower planting, and particularly discloses an artificial pollination device for flower planting, which comprises a storage cylinder, the arc surface of the storage cylinder is communicated with a feed pipe, a round rod is mounted on the arc surface of the storage cylinder, the bottom of the storage cylinder is communicated with a discharge pipe, and one end, far away from the storage cylinder, of the discharge pipe is communicated with a brush head. A plurality of leaking holes are formed in the arc surface of the brush head, the arc surface of the feeding pipe is in threaded connection with a blocking cover, a blocking plate is arranged in the storage cylinder, and the end, away from the blocking plate, of the sliding column penetrates through the storage cylinder in a sliding mode. The blocking plate is arranged in the storage barrel, pollen in the storage barrel can be blocked, the situation that the pollen directly falls out is avoided as much as possible, the sliding column drives the blocking plate to move up and down, the pollen can intermittently fall into the brush head, and the situation that the pollen is wasted is avoided as much as possible; and the storage cylinder is driven by the fixing plate to rotate, so that the brush head can shake.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model belongs to the field of flower planting technology, specifically relating to an artificial pollination device for flower planting. Background Technology

[0002] Artificial pollination refers to the process of transferring plant pollen to the stigma of the pistil using artificial methods to achieve plant reproduction.

[0003] In the field of floriculture, artificial pollination is necessary when pollinator trees are lacking or when adverse weather conditions during the flowering period affect normal natural pollination. Pollinators are typically used during pollination.

[0004] In Chinese patent publication number CN220916097U, an artificial pollinator is mentioned. Its specification discloses that pollen in the pollen storage tank falls into the pollination head on the lower side under the action of gravity and is discharged through the pollen outlet and adheres to the bristles. The bristles can then be used to spread the pollen onto the flowers, which facilitates pollination and reduces the loss of pollen in the air, thus reducing pollen waste and improving pollination quality.

[0005] In the aforementioned application, the pollen in the pollen storage tank falls down by gravity, and no measures are taken to block the pollen. Therefore, the pollen in the storage tank will continue to fall downwards under the influence of gravity. When the pollen accumulates to a certain extent, or when the staff shakes the entire pollinator, the pollen is likely to fall out from the holes on the pollinator head, resulting in pollen waste. Utility Model Content

[0006] The purpose of this invention is to provide an artificial pollination device for flower cultivation, so as to solve the problem that existing pollinators in the prior art are prone to pollen waste.

[0007] To achieve the above objectives, this utility model provides the following technical solution:

[0008] An artificial pollination device for flower cultivation includes a storage cylinder, an inlet pipe connected to the arc surface of the storage cylinder, a round rod installed on the arc surface of the storage cylinder, a discharge pipe connected to the bottom of the storage cylinder, and a brush head connected to the end of the discharge pipe away from the storage cylinder. The arc surface of the brush head has multiple perforations.

[0009] Preferably, the feed pipe has a plug connected to the arc-shaped threaded surface.

[0010] Preferably, the storage cylinder has a blocking plate inside, and a sliding column is fixedly connected to the end face of the blocking plate. The end of the sliding column away from the blocking plate slides through the storage cylinder, and a fixing plate is fixedly connected to the top of the sliding column.

[0011] Preferably, the arc surface of the storage cylinder is rotatably connected to a ring, and the round rod is fixedly connected to the arc surface of the ring.

[0012] Preferably, the cylindrical rod is slidably connected to the arc surface of the cylindrical rod, and the arc surface of the cylindrical rod is provided with anti-slip stripes.

[0013] Preferably, a spring is fixedly connected to the top of the storage cylinder, and the end of the spring away from the storage cylinder is fixedly connected to the fixing plate.

[0014] Compared with the prior art, the beneficial effects of this utility model are:

[0015] 1. This utility model, by placing the blocking plate inside the storage cylinder, can block the pollen inside the storage cylinder and minimize the occurrence of pollen falling directly out. By moving the blocking plate up and down through the sliding column, pollen can be intermittently falling into the brush head, minimizing pollen waste.

[0016] 2. This utility model uses a fixed plate to drive the rotation of the storage cylinder, which makes the brush head shake, so as to shake off the pollen on the brush head bristles and avoid the brush head directly contacting the pistil and causing damage to the pistil. [0023] Reference Figures 1-4 As shown, this utility model provides an artificial pollination device for flower planting, including a storage cylinder 1, a feed pipe 2 connected to the arc surface of the storage cylinder 1, a round rod 5 installed on the arc surface of the storage cylinder 1, a discharge pipe 6 connected to the bottom of the storage cylinder 1, a brush head 7 connected to the end of the discharge pipe 6 away from the storage cylinder 1, and a plurality of leakage holes 701 opened on the arc surface of the brush head 7.

[0024] In this embodiment, the brush head 7 is provided with multiple bristles. With the help of the perforation 701, pollen can be leaked out. Under the action of the bristles, the pollen is not easy to fall off and will be adsorbed on the dense bristles.

[0025] In an optional embodiment, the feed pipe 2 is threaded with a plug 3 on its arc-shaped surface.

[0026] It should be noted that the plug 3 is secured to the feed pipe 2 by means of a threaded drive, thereby sealing the feed pipe 2 and preventing dust and moisture from entering the storage cylinder 1.

[0027] In an optional embodiment: the storage cylinder 1 is provided with a blocking plate 9 inside, and a sliding column 10 is fixedly connected to the end face of the blocking plate 9. The end of the sliding column 10 away from the blocking plate 9 slides through the storage cylinder 1, and a fixing plate 11 is fixedly connected to the top of the sliding column 10.

[0028] It should be noted that the sliding column 10 drives the blocking plate 9 to slide up and down, which facilitates the intermittent falling of pollen into the brush head 7, and minimizes the accumulation of pollen.

[0029] In an optional embodiment: the arc surface of the storage cylinder 1 is rotatably connected to a ring 4, and the round rod 5 is fixedly connected to the arc surface of the ring 4.

[0030] It should be noted that the rotation between the ring 4 and the storage cylinder 1 facilitates the shaking of the brush head 7 and the back-and-forth rotation of the storage cylinder 1, so as to shake off the pollen on the brush head 7 and avoid the brush head 7 directly contacting the pistil and damaging it as much as possible.

[0031] In an optional embodiment: the circular rod 5 is slidably connected to the circular arc surface of the cylinder 8, and the circular arc surface of the cylinder 8 is provided with anti-slip stripes.

[0032] It should be noted that there is damping between the round rod 5 and the cylinder 8, so it is not easy to slide without external force. The sliding between the round rod 5 and the cylinder 8 is conducive to adjusting the length of the round rod 5. The arc surface of the cylinder 8 is provided with anti-slip stripes to increase the friction.

[0033] In an optional embodiment: a spring 12 is fixedly connected to the top of the storage cylinder 1, and the end of the spring 12 away from the storage cylinder 1 is fixedly connected to the fixing plate 11.

[0034] It should be noted that spring 12 serves to make the sealing plate 9 more secure.

[0035] The working principle of this utility model is as follows: In use, pollen is loaded into the storage cylinder 1 through the feed pipe 2. The feed pipe 2 is sealed by the threaded drive of the plug 3. Then, holding the cylinder 8 with one hand and the fixing plate 11 with the other, the fixing plate 11 is pulled upward, which drives the plug 9 to move. The spring 12 is in a deformed state. At this time, the pollen inside the storage cylinder 1 will fall downward into the discharge pipe 6. When the fixing plate 11 is released, the spring 12 rebounds, and the plug 9 re-seals the gap between the storage cylinder 1 and the discharge pipe 6. The pollen inside the discharge pipe 6 will be adsorbed onto the brush bristles through the leakage hole 701. The brush head 7 is aligned with the flower to be pollinated. At this time, the fixing plate 11 is rotated back and forth, so that the storage cylinder 1 rotates back and forth, so as to shake off the pollen on the brush head 7 and avoid the brush head 7 directly contacting the pistil and damaging the pistil as much as possible.
